I. Understanding Legal Guardianship
Legal guardianship grants a person (the guardian) the authorized authority and duty to make private and/or monetary choices for one more particular person (the ward) who’s deemed incapable of creating these choices for themselves. This authority isn’t voluntary; it’s conferred by a court docket order and is all the time meant to act within the “greatest curiosity of the ward.” The scope of a guardian’s powers can fluctuate considerably based mostly on the ward’s wants and the particular court docket order.
II. Types of Guardianship
The nature of guardianship varies relying on the age and capability of the ward, in addition to the particular areas of their life requiring administration.
A. Guardianship of a Minor
This sort of guardianship is established when dad and mom are deceased, incapacitated, or deemed unfit by the court docket to care for his or her baby. A guardian of a minor assumes parental duties, together with choices associated to the kid’s well being, schooling, every day care, and residing preparations. This differs from adoption, because the organic dad and mom should still retain sure rights and the guardianship might be terminated if circumstances change.
B. Guardianship of an Incapacitated Adult
When an grownup turns into unable to handle their private care, medical choices, or monetary affairs due to sickness, incapacity, age, or damage, a court docket might appoint a guardian. This usually entails detailed medical evaluations to affirm the person’s incapacity. The purpose is to present crucial assist whereas preserving as a lot of the grownup’s autonomy as doable.
C. Guardianship of the Person vs. Guardianship of the Estate
Guardianship might be break up into two major roles:
* Guardianship of the Person: This guardian makes choices relating to the ward’s private welfare, together with medical therapy, residing preparations, every day care, schooling, and social actions.
* Guardianship of the Estate (or Conservatorship): This guardian manages the ward’s monetary affairs, property, belongings, and earnings. They are accountable for paying payments, investing funds, and guaranteeing the ward’s monetary stability, topic to court docket oversight.
It is widespread for one particular person to function each guardian of the particular person and property, however typically these roles are break up between completely different people, notably for advanced monetary conditions.

B. Essential Legal Documents Required
The following are the first authorized paperwork sometimes concerned in establishing authorized guardianship:
1. Petition for Guardianship:
* Purpose: This is the foundational doc that formally requests the court docket to appoint a guardian. It should clearly state why guardianship is critical, who the proposed ward and guardian are, and what powers the guardian is in search of.
* Contents: Includes figuring out data for all events, the proposed ward’s present scenario (e.g., incapacity, lack of appropriate dad and mom), the proposed guardian’s {qualifications}, and an outline of the ward’s belongings (if property guardianship is sought). It usually features a sworn assertion (affidavit or declaration) from the petitioner.
2. Notice of Hearing:
* Purpose: Ensures due course of by formally informing all events (the proposed ward, fast relations, and anybody else with a authorized curiosity) concerning the guardianship petition and the date, time, and site of the court docket listening to.
* Contents: Details of the petition, the proposed guardian, and directions on how to object or take part within the listening to. Proof of service (exhibiting that each one events obtained the discover) is essential.
3. Medical or Psychological Evaluation (for Adult Guardianship):
* Purpose: Provides official documentation of the proposed grownup ward’s psychological and/or bodily incapacity, which is a prerequisite for grownup guardianship.
* Contents: An in depth report from a certified doctor, psychiatrist, or psychologist outlining the person’s situation, their potential to make choices, and the extent of their incapacity.
4. Background Checks and Affidavits of Proposed Guardian:
* Purpose: To assess the suitability and health of the person requesting guardianship.
* Contents: May embrace felony background checks, credit score stories, and sworn affidavits from the proposed guardian testifying to their {qualifications}, absence of conflicts of curiosity, and dedication to the ward’s greatest curiosity.
5. Guardian Ad Litem Report (if relevant):
* Purpose: In many jurisdictions, the court docket appoints an impartial investigator or legal professional (Guardian Ad Litem) to symbolize the most effective pursuits of the proposed ward, particularly minors or adults with important incapacity.
* Contents: The GAL conducts interviews, critiques paperwork, and submits a report to the court docket with suggestions relating to the need and suitability of the proposed guardianship.
6. Order Appointing Guardian:
* Purpose: This is the official court docket doc that, as soon as signed by the choose, formally establishes the guardianship and confers authorized authority upon the appointed guardian.
* Contents: Specifies the guardian’s identification, the ward’s identification, the scope of the guardian’s powers (e.g., guardianship of particular person, property, or each), any limitations, and reporting necessities.
7. Letters of Guardianship (or Letters of Conservatorship):
* Purpose: These are licensed copies of the court docket order, serving as proof of the guardian’s authorized authority to third events (e.g., banks, medical suppliers, faculties).
* Contents: A proper certification by the court docket clerk, validating the guardian’s appointment and powers.
8. Guardian’s Oath and Bond:
* Purpose: The oath is a sworn promise by the guardian to faithfully execute their duties. A bond (a kind of insurance coverage coverage) could also be required, notably for guardianship of an property, to defend the ward’s belongings from mismanagement or fraud.
* Contents: The oath is a straightforward sworn assertion. The bond specifies the quantity of protection and the phrases.
9. Initial Inventory of Assets (for Estate Guardianship):
* Purpose: To present the court docket with an entire accounting of all belongings belonging to the ward’s property on the time guardianship is established.
* Contents: An in depth listing of all actual property, financial institution accounts, investments, private property, and money owed belonging to the ward.
10. Annual Reports/Accountings:
* Purpose: Ongoing court docket oversight is a trademark of guardianship. Guardians are required to usually report on the ward’s private standing and, for property guardians, present detailed monetary accountings.
* Contents: A private standing report particulars the ward’s well being, residing scenario, and general well-being. A monetary accounting particulars all earnings obtained and bills paid from the ward’s property.
C. Court Proceedings
After submitting the petition and serving discover, the court docket will sometimes schedule a listening to. The choose will evaluate all submitted paperwork, hear testimony from events, and think about the suggestions of any Guardian Ad Litem. The court docket’s major goal is to decide if guardianship is really crucial and if the proposed guardian is probably the most appropriate particular person to act within the ward’s greatest curiosity.
IV. Responsibilities of a Legal Guardian
Once appointed, a authorized guardian assumes important duties. These embrace:
* Fiduciary Duty: Acting with the best stage of care, loyalty, and good religion, all the time prioritizing the ward’s greatest pursuits over their very own.
* Decision-Making: Making knowledgeable choices relating to the ward’s care, medical therapy, schooling, residing preparations, and monetary administration, as outlined within the court docket order.
* Reporting to the Court: Submitting common private standing stories and monetary accountings, as required by the court docket, to guarantee transparency and accountability.
* Protection: Safeguarding the ward from abuse, neglect, exploitation, and guaranteeing their bodily, emotional, and monetary safety.

FAQs about Establishing Legal Guardianship
Q1: How a lot does it price to set up authorized guardianship?
A1: The price varies considerably relying on the state, the complexity of the case, and whether or not an legal professional is retained. Fees can embrace court docket submitting charges, legal professional charges, course of server charges, and doubtlessly charges for medical evaluations or Guardian Ad Litem appointments. It can vary from a number of hundred {dollars} for fundamental submitting charges to a number of thousand {dollars} with authorized illustration.
Q2: Do I want a lawyer to set up authorized guardianship?
A2: While it’s technically doable to petition for guardianship with out an legal professional in some jurisdictions, it’s extremely advisable to interact one. Guardianship legal guidelines are advanced, fluctuate by state, and contain particular procedures and documentation. An legal professional can guarantee all authorized necessities are met, keep away from pricey errors, symbolize your pursuits, and navigate potential objections.
Q3: What’s the distinction between guardianship and energy of legal professional (POA)?
A3: A Power of Attorney is a authorized doc the place a person (the principal) voluntarily designates one other particular person (the agent) to make choices on their behalf whereas they’re nonetheless succesful. It turns into efficient instantly or upon a selected occasion. Guardianship, conversely, is established by a court docket when a person is deemed incapacitated and unable to make their very own choices. A guardian’s authority comes from a choose, not from the ward’s prior consent, and entails ongoing court docket oversight.
This autumn: Can a authorized guardianship be terminated?
A4: Yes, a authorized guardianship might be terminated by a court docket order. This sometimes happens if the ward regains capability (for an grownup), reaches authorized age (for a minor), or if the guardian is now not ready to serve. The court docket should be petitioned for termination and can evaluate proof to guarantee termination is within the ward’s greatest curiosity.
Q5: How lengthy does it take to set up authorized guardianship?
A5: The timeframe varies extensively relying on the court docket’s schedule, the complexity of the case, whether or not there are any contested points, and state-specific necessities. It can take wherever from a number of weeks in an uncontested, easy case to a number of months and even over a yr if there are disputes or intensive investigations required.
Q6: What if multiple particular person needs to be the guardian?
A6: If a number of appropriate people petition for guardianship, the court docket will maintain a listening to to decide who’s greatest suited to function guardian, all the time prioritizing the ward’s greatest curiosity. The choose will think about elements just like the proposed guardian’s relationship with the ward, their capability to carry out the duties, monetary stability, and any preferences expressed by the ward (if they’ve some capability).
